Report Highlights

This Report:

  • The global market for RNA interference (RNAi) was $145.2 million in 2007 and is expected to reach $174.5 million by the end of 2008. It should reach $3.6 billion by 2013, a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 83.4%.
  • RNAi is already an established enabling biotechnology product platform and its future use in diagnostics and therapeutics may rival such products as recombinant proteins or monoclonal antibodies.
  • The growth rate of the research and development tools market segment is forecast to be a robust 19.5% per year during the study period to reach $424.5 million in 2013.

INTRODUCTION

BCC's goal for this study is to determine the status of current and emerging RNA interference (RNAi) technologies and products and to assess their worldwide growth potential over a 5-year period, from 2008 to 2013. Our particular interest is to characterize and quantify the RNAi market potential for research tools, drug target discovery and validation, diagnostics, therapeutics and agriculture: market segments which will provide substantial future growth opportunities for RNAi.

Our key objectives are to present a comprehensive discussion of the current state-of-the-art in RNA interference technologies, and to assess the present and future commercial potential for the key market segments.
